I FREAKIN' TOLD YOU GUYS... CHRONOGRAPHS CANNOT BE TRUSTED!

Now... just shoot the drop... and then go plug the numbers into a ballistics program... it'll get you close. I'd rather know the actuall drops out to 800... than know the exact velocity and trust a program (or a cooked-up BDC turret) to give me my drop data!
